Change Water Frequently

Change Water Frequently

Fresh clean waters can cut flowers a longer life. Every two days, the water of the vase needs to be changed. The vase needs to be properly clean before re-placing the bouquet. Sometimes, adding plant food to the freshwater also helps the cut flowers live longer. Use Flower Food

Use Flower Food

Like us, flowers also need food to survive. Plants provide food to flowers; however, cut flowers devoid of such need. Hence, it is best to use some small packets of flower food for the cut flowers. These food packets contain sugar for the flowers, bleach to reduce the fungi and bacteria, and acid to balance the pH level of the water. All three ingredients would give some extra liveliness and life to flowers for some time. One can get the proper flower food from the plant delivery sites.

Place It In The Right Spot

Place It In The Right Spot

Many times the spot of the flowers where we keep the vases determines the life of the bouquets. Usually cut flower bouquets are best kept away from sunlight. They thrive better in shady areas. Also, keep the flower bouquets away from certain appliances that radiate heat. In cool temperatures, away from direct sunlight is the place is where to plan flower décor ideas at home. In the house, it is also advisable to keep the flower away from vegetables and fruits as they give out ethylene gas, toxic for flowers.

Remove Water Foliage

Remove Water Foliage

The first thing to keep in mind while placing a floral bouquet into vases is to keep the foliages above the water. If somehow some part of the arrangement gets into or remains in the water, it is best to immediately remove them. Foliages or petals immersed in water or in touch with them rot quickly; also the bacteria attack them immediately. If they are not removed, they can also cause damage to the growth of the other flowers in the arrangement. Hence, they must be immediately removed.
